Newman 5332074 151220267 NWMN_0055 AP009351 YP_001331090 immunoglobulin G binding protein A precursor (protein A) Virulence factor An isogenic spa deletion variant S. aureus Newman Δspa was generated. After intraperitoneal challenge with 2 × 10^8 CFU of wild-type S. aureus Newman, 60% of animals succumbed to challenge. In contrast, animals infected with the isogenic mutant resulted in only 25% mortality. In addition, the spa mutant displayed a consistent survival defect when examined in naive mouse blood. These results suggest that SpA is a crucial virulence factor for lethal infections of S. aureus in mice [Ref7423:Kim et al., 2010].
